Summary
This episode is raw, reflective, and deeply human. Brian opens up about a realization that hits years after coming out: you don’t just come out once—you keep coming out, over and over again. And sometimes, that means revisiting the past and facing the people you may have unintentionally hurt along the way. From painful conversations with family and friends, to questioning his own voice and purpose, Brian wrestles with a heavy question: “Who am I to be doing this podcast?” Mark grounds the conversation in perspective, reminding us that we make the best decisions we can with the information we have at the time—and that growth often comes with hindsight. Together, they unpack: • The emotional aftershocks of coming out later in life • The tension between external validation vs. internal self-worth • How books like The Velvet Rage frame the journey from shame → validation → authenticity • The reality of modern dating: ghosting, rejection, and unexpected connection • Letting go of rigid “types” and discovering attraction in deeper, more meaningful ways This episode doesn’t offer perfect answers—because there aren’t any. Instead, it offers something more valuable: honesty, growth, and the reminder that you’re not alone in the mess of becoming who you truly are.
